With data in hand, it’s time to start the analysis by placing items in their proper stock categories. A items are the top-priority items with the highest consumption value, B items are important but have a lower consumption value, and C items are the lowest priority.

An ABC analysis can overvalue frequently purchased items that get people in the door over luxury goods with a lower purchase frequency but higher profit margin. ABC analysis can also miss swings in demand for seasonal items or new items that haven’t accrued much sales volume data. With the right attention and https://globalcloudteam.com/ encouragement, these items have potential to become group A customers. Do you know the Pareto principle, also known as the 80/20 rule? The principle, created by the Italian economist Vilfredo Pareto, states that 80% of the effects come from 20% of the causes.

Otherwise, you’re stuck counting all inventory items at the same time intervals. ABC analysis lets you customize your cycle counting process, which optimizes inventory control for your unique needs. For example, you might decide that your A items should be counted every month, while B items only need to be counted every quarter.
